DIGEST 

Currently the Texas Department of Criminal Justice (TDCJ) conducts a Texas
Crime Information Center/National Crime Information Center criminal history
check on all new admissions to the prison system. Should there be an
outstanding warrant, the department contacts the appropriate jurisdiction
to ask whether it wishes to place a detainer on the inmate. If a warrant is
issued after an inmate has entered the prison system, the entity placing
the warrant can verify that the inmate is incarcerated in the department
and contact the department if it wants to place a detainer on the inmate.
H.B. 854 requires the department to check for warrants at the time of
release to insure that outstanding warrants are addressed before releasing
an inmate or defendant from custody.  

PURPOSE

As proposed, H.B. 854 requires the identification of certain persons
confined by the Texas Department of Criminal Justice who are subject to a
warrant.

SECTION BY SECTION ANALYSIS

SECTION 1. Amends Chapter 493, Government Code, by adding Section 493.0145,
as follows:  

Sec. 493.0145. IDENTIFICATION OF INMATES SUBJECT TO ARREST WARRANT.
Requires the Texas Department of Criminal (TDCJ)  to conduct a criminal
history record check to determine whether the inmate is the subject of an
arrest warrant, before an inmate is discharged or is released on parole or
mandatory supervision from TDCJ. Requires the department, in conducting the
criminal history record check, to allow sufficient time for compliance with
any requirements related to notifying the proper authorities of the
inmate's discharge or release and, if necessary, processing a demand for
extradition of the inmate.  

SECTION 2. Amends Chapter 507B, Government Code,  by adding Section
507.032, as follows: 

Sec. 507.032. IDENTIFICATION OF DEFENDANTS SUBJECT TO ARREST WARRANT.
Requires the department to conduct a criminal history record check to
determine whether the defendant is the subject of a warrant, before a
defendant is released from confinement in a state jail felony facility.
Requires the department to allow sufficient time for compliance with any
requirements related to notify the proper authorities of the defendant's
release and, if necessary, processing a demand for extradition of the
defendant.  

SECTION 3. Effective date: September 1, 1999.

SECTION 4. Emergency clause.





 SUMMARY OF COMMITTEE CHANGES

SECTION 1. 

Amends Section 493.0145, Government Code, to require the department, in
conducting the criminal history record check, to allow sufficient time for
processing a demand for extradition of the inmate. 

SECTION 2.

 Amends Section 507.032, Government Code, to make a conforming change.
